Abacus Lofts
CDs to completion: Quadrangle Architects; Design: RAW (Richard Witt Partner in Charge) Toronto / Canada / 2010

In a neighbourhood undergoing a major revitalization, the dynamic mid-rise form of Abacus will be the first major residential development along Dundas Street West. Shaped by the principles of the City of Toronto’s Avenues and Mid-rise Guidelines, Abacus’ eight storeys step back and forward vertically and horizontally to provide additional pedestrian area at the ground while reflecting the diagonal direction of Dundas Street. Clad in rich dark grey fibre composite panels and grey brick, the building’s floor to ceiling windows and glass balustrades will provide residents with uninhibited views along Dundas and south to the city skyline.
